¡Vamos Verde! is a podcast about Austin FC and the community that has grown up around the team. From player interviews to looks behind the curtain at what makes the team and the community thrive – it’s a soccer podcast for everyone. Hosted by Jimmy Maas and Juan Garcia and produced by KUT & KUTX Studios in collaboration with Austin FC. Fútbol Política y Gobierno

  • The One With The Calendar
    Nov 20 2025

    Major League Soccer announced a big change this week. The league is shifting its calendar to align with the top leagues in the sport. Instead of playing matches from January to November, the 2027-28 season will begin in late July with a champion crowned in May.

  • The One With The Armadillo
    Nov 6 2025

    Austin FC will get a new away shirt next season, set to replace the “Amadillo” shirt introduced ahead of the 2024 season. The shirt paid homage to the legendary Armadillo World Headquarters, the Austin music venue at the epicenter of the cosmic cowboy music wave. The shirt also gave Austin FC a mascot: an armadillo named Speed Bump. ‘Dillo handler Swift Sparks tells us all about Speed Bump’s celebrity, what it takes to care for him, and what the future holds for their partnership with Austin FC.

  • The One With Diego Rubio
    Oct 16 2025

    Austin FC is headed to the 2025 MLS playoffs. A key reason for that is Diego Rubio. The veteran stepped into a bigger-than-anticipated role after Brandon Vázquez's season-ending injury. Rubio turned pro at age 17 in his native Chile. His passion to compete and penchant for scoring goals got the attention of the Chilean National Team. He played for clubs in Portugal, Spain, Kansas City, and Denver before joining Austin FC last year. Rubio joins hosts Jimmy Maas and Juan Diego Garcia to talk about his maturation as a player, the importance of family, and building a legacy.
